Decoding the Five-Star Standard: What Bharat NCAP Signifies

To truly appreciate the significance of this rating, it’s essential to understand the BNCAP framework. Launched as India’s indigenous vehicle safety assessment program, Bharat NCAP aligns closely with global benchmarks like Euro NCAP, ANCAP, and Latin NCAP. Its primary objective is to provide Indian consumers with transparent, comparable car safety ratings based on rigorous crash tests. A five-star rating from BNCAP, therefore, isn’t just an arbitrary number; it’s a comprehensive validation of a vehicle’s structural integrity, restraint systems, and overall occupant protection capabilities under severe impact conditions.
The Harrier and Safari’s scores—30.08 out of 32 points for adult occupant protection and 44.54 out of 49 points for child occupant protection—are exemplary. These figures reflect exceptional performance across various impact scenarios, including frontal offset deformable barrier tests and side impact tests. Achieving near-perfect scores in adult protection highlights the efficacy of their high-strength steel chassis, precisely engineered crumple zones, and advanced airbag systems. The high child occupant protection score is equally commendable, indicating meticulous attention to ISOFIX child seat anchorage points and the vehicle’s ability to minimize injury risk to younger passengers, a crucial consideration for family SUVs. Beyond the Rating: Engineering Excellence in Action
A five-star Tata Harrier Safari crash test result is not an accident; it’s the culmination of years of research, development, and significant investment in automotive safety innovation. At the heart of these SUVs lies Tata Motors’ OMEGARC architecture, a derivative of Land Rover’s D8 platform. This foundational strength provides an inherent advantage, offering a robust base that can be further refined for specific market conditions and powertrain requirements.
When we talk about vehicle structural integrity, we’re referring to the ability of the car’s body shell to absorb and distribute crash forces away from the passenger cell. The Harrier and Safari’s chassis are strategically reinforced with high-strength and ultra-high-strength steel in critical areas, acting as a protective cage around occupants. This material science expertise is vital. Furthermore, the integration of multiple airbags (up to seven in some variants), pre-tensioner seatbelts, and load limiters ensures that in the event of a collision, the forces exerted on occupants are managed to mitigate severe injuries.
The extension of the five-star rating to the petrol variants is particularly noteworthy. Often, different powertrains can lead to variations in weight distribution, front-end structural components, and engine bay packaging, which might influence crash performance. Tata Motors has clearly ensured that the integration of the 1.5-litre Hyperion TGDi turbo-petrol engine maintains the same high standards of car crash test performance. This consistent approach across powertrains reinforces consumer confidence in the brand’s overarching commitment to safety, regardless of the fuel type chosen. The Hyperion TGDi Engine: Powering Safety Forward
The introduction of the 1.5-liter Hyperion TGDi turbo-petrol engine is a significant strategic move. With an output of 158bhp and 255Nm of torque, paired with both six-speed manual and torque converter automatic transmissions, this engine offers a compelling blend of performance and efficiency. However, from a safety perspective, its seamless integration without compromising the existing BNCAP rating is the real triumph. It demonstrates advanced vehicle safety engineering, where powertrain development and structural design are synchronized from the outset.

Beyond Passive Safety: Active Safety Systems and 2025 Trends
While crash tests primarily evaluate passive safety (how a vehicle protects occupants during a crash), the future of road safety is increasingly defined by active safety systems – technologies that help prevent accidents in the first place. The Harrier and Safari, especially in their newer iterations, are equipped with a suite of advanced driver assistance systems (ADAS), including features like Forward Collision Warning, Autonomous Emergency Braking, Lane Departure Warning, Blind Spot Detection, and Adaptive Cruise Control.
These systems leverage radar, cameras, and ultrasonic sensors to constantly monitor the vehicle’s surroundings, alerting drivers to potential hazards and, in some cases, intervening automatically. For 2025 and beyond, we will see even more sophisticated ADAS, including enhanced pedestrian and cyclist detection, junction assist, and increasingly capable semi-autonomous driving features. These accident avoidance systems are becoming non-negotiable for discerning buyers and contribute significantly to a vehicle’s overall vehicle safety performance. The combination of a strong passive safety foundation, as validated by the Tata Harrier Safari crash test, with robust active safety systems, creates a truly comprehensive safety package. Furthermore, the trend towards connected car technologies will further augment safety. Features like e-Call (automatic emergency call in case of a crash), real-time vehicle diagnostics, and over-the-air (OTA) updates for safety systems are becoming standard. These innovations mean vehicles are not only safer when they leave the factory but can also become safer over their lifespan through software improvements.
